Sarcoma Clinical Trial
Official title:
Randomized Study Comparing Neoadjuvant Chemotherapy Etoposide + Ifosfamide + Adriamycin (EIA) Combined With Regional Hyperthermia (RHT) Versus Neoadjuvant Chemotherapy Alone in the Treatment of High-Risk Soft Tissue Sarcomas in Adults
RATIONALE: Drugs used in chemotherapy use different ways to stop tumor cells from dividing
so they stop growing or die. Hyperthermia therapy kills tumor cells by heating them to
several degrees above body temperature. It is not known whether receiving chemotherapy plus
hyperthermia is more effective than receiving chemotherapy alone in treating patients with
soft tissue sarcoma.
PURPOSE: This randomized phase III trial is studying combination chemotherapy alone to see
how well it works compared to combination chemotherapy and hyperthermia therapy in treating
patients with soft tissue sarcoma.
OBJECTIVES:
- Determine local progression-free survival of patients with high-risk soft tissue
sarcoma treated with neoadjuvant etoposide, ifosfamide, and doxorubicin with or without
regional hyperthermia.
- Determine the tumor response rate, local disease control rate, and overall survival in
patients treated with this regimen.
OUTLINE: This is a randomized study. Patients are stratified according to high-risk category
(S1 vs S2 vs S3) and disease site (extremity vs nonextremity). Patients are randomized to
one of two treatment arms.
- Arm I: Patients receive etoposide IV over 30 minutes on days 1 and 4, ifosfamide IV
over 60 minutes on days 1-4, and doxorubicin IV over 30 minutes on day 1. Treatment
continues every 21 days for a total of 4 courses. Patients also undergo regional
hyperthermia.
- Arm II: Patients receive chemotherapy alone as in arm I. Patients in both arms undergo
definitive surgery 4-6 weeks after chemotherapy. Patients also undergo radiotherapy
beginning 4-6 weeks after surgery. After completion of surgery and radiotherapy,
patients with non-resectable tumors showing no disease progression receive an
additional 4 courses of chemotherapy with or without regional hyperthermia according to
above treatment schedule.
Patients are followed every 3 months for 1 year, every 4 months for 2 years, and then every
6 months thereafter.
PROJECTED ACCRUAL: A total of 340 patients (170 patients per arm) will be accrued for this
study within 3.5 years.
